My 04 STI pinged audibly on 91 octane when it was new and stock. I think there was a factory reflash for this. I see stock STI's with IAM <1 and lots of knock learning sometimes (when I hook up to check them). I really think the stock tune is meant for 93 octane.

The newer STI tunes stay in closed loop (targeting 14+:1) too long for emissions reasons, and this leads to knock, even moreso with an aftermarket downpipe and no tune.
